IIFL Samasta, a Non-Banking Finance Company – Micro Finance Institution (NBFC MFI) in India, focuses on providing innovative and affordable financial products to women enrolled as members and organized as Joint Liability Groups (JLGs). The target demographic includes individuals from unbanked sections of society, such as cultivators, agricultural laborers, vegetable and flower vendors, cloth traders, tailors, craftsmen, as well as household and industrial workers across rural, semi-urban, and urban areas in India.
The company has launched its Non-Convertible Debentures (NCDs) on December 4, with each lot comprising 10 NCDs priced at Rs 1000 per NCD. Investors have the opportunity to subscribe to the issue until December 15.
As of December 7, 2023, at 12:59:00 PM, the IIFL Samasta Finance NCD Tranche I Nov 2023 witnessed a subscription rate of 1.25 times. The subscription details indicate a 1.00 times subscription in the Retail category, 1.77 times in the High Net Worth Individual (HNI) category, 1.35 times in the Non-Institutional category, and 0.10 times in the Institutional category.
